Boil the milk (full cream or normal; doesn't come out so well with skimmed milk). Let it cool to luke warm. Take 1 tsp. yoghurt (previously made or that you get from the supermarket)for about 500ml milk, spread it in a dish or container. Add the milk and mix well with a tsp. Leave it for 6-8 hours (or overnight). Voila! you will get lovely thick yoghurt. In winters, I tend to wrap it up with something warm (blanket or old sweater). Enjoy your yoghurt!
